Esta referencia de la API está organizada por tipo de recurso. Cada tipo de recurso tiene una o más representaciones de datos y uno o más métodos.
Tipos de recursos
- Cuentas
- Versiones de contenedores
- Contenedores
- Entornos
- Environments.reauthorize_environments
- Carpetas
- Folders.entities
- Folders.move_folders
- Permisos
- Etiquetas
- Activadores
- Variables
Cuentas
Para obtener los detalles del recurso de cuentas,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
get |
GET /accounts/accountId
|
Obtiene una cuenta de GTM. |
list |
GET /accounts
|
Indica todas las cuentas de GTM a las que tiene acceso un usuario. |
actualizar |
PUT /accounts/accountId
|
Actualiza una cuenta de GTM. |
Versiones de contenedor
Para obtener más información sobre los recursos de las versiones de contenedor,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/versions
|
Crea una versión de contenedor. |
borrar |
DELETE /accounts/accountId/containers/containerId/versions/containerVersionId
|
Borra una versión de contenedor. |
get |
GET /accounts/accountId/containers/containerId/versions/containerVersionId
|
Obtiene una versión del contenedor. |
list |
GET /accounts/accountId/containers/containerId/versions
|
Muestra una lista de todas las versiones de un contenedor de GTM. |
publish |
POST /accounts/accountId/containers/containerId/versions/containerVersionId/publish
|
Publica una versión del contenedor. |
restablecer |
POST /accounts/accountId/containers/containerId/versions/containerVersionId/restore
|
Restablece una versión de contenedor. Esto reemplazará la configuración actual del contenedor (incluidas sus variables, activadores y etiquetas). La operación no tendrá ningún efecto en la versión publicada (es decir, la versión publicada). |
undelete |
POST /accounts/accountId/containers/containerId/versions/containerVersionId/undelete
|
Recupera una versión de contenedor. |
actualizar |
PUT /accounts/accountId/containers/containerId/versions/containerVersionId
|
Actualiza una versión de contenedor. |
Contenedores
Para obtener más información sobre los recursos de contenedores,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ers
|
Crea un contenedor. |
borrar |
DELETE /accounts/accountId/containers/containerId
|
Borra un contenedor. |
get |
GET /accounts/accountId/containers/containerId
|
Obtiene un contenedor. |
list |
GET /accounts/accountId/containers
|
Se muestran todos los contenedores que pertenecen a una cuenta de GTM. |
actualizar |
PUT /accounts/accountId/containers/containerId
|
Actualiza un contenedor. |
Entornos
Para obtener detalles sobre los recursos de entornos,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/environments
|
Crea un entorno de GTM. |
borrar |
DELETE /accounts/accountId/containers/containerId/environments/environmentId
|
Borra un entorno de GTM. |
get |
GET /accounts/accountId/containers/containerId/environments/environmentId
|
Obtiene un entorno de GTM. |
list |
GET /accounts/accountId/containers/containerId/environments
|
Se muestran todos los entornos de GTM de un contenedor de GTM. |
actualizar |
PUT /accounts/accountId/containers/containerId/environments/environmentId
|
Actualiza un entorno de GTM. |
Environments.reauthorize_environments
Para obtener más información sobre los recursos Environments.reauthorize_environments,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
actualizar |
PUT /accounts/accountId/containers/containerId/reauthorize_environments/environmentId
|
Vuelve a generar el código de autorización para un entorno de GTM. |
Carpetas
Para obtener más información sobre los recursos de carpetas,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/folders
|
Crea una carpeta de GTM. |
borrar |
DELETE /accounts/accountId/containers/containerId/folders/folderId
|
Elimina una carpeta de GTM. |
get |
GET /accounts/accountId/containers/containerId/folders/folderId
|
Obtiene una carpeta de GTM. |
list |
GET /accounts/accountId/containers/containerId/folders
|
Muestra una lista de todas las carpetas de GTM de un contenedor. |
actualizar |
PUT /accounts/accountId/containers/containerId/folders/folderId
|
Actualiza una carpeta de GTM. |
Folders.entities
Para obtener más información sobre los recursos de Folders.entities,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
list |
GET /accounts/accountId/containers/containerId/folders/folderId/entities
|
Enumera todas las entidades en una carpeta de GTM. |
Folders.move_folders
Para obtener los detalles de los recursos Folders.move_folders,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
actualizar |
PUT /accounts/accountId/containers/containerId/move_folders/folderId
|
Mueve las entidades a una carpeta de GTM. |
Permisos
Para obtener más información sobre los recursos de permisos,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/permissions
|
Crea la cuenta de un usuario y los permisos del contenedor. |
borrar |
DELETE /accounts/accountId/permissions/permissionId
|
Quita un usuario de la cuenta y revoca el acceso a ella y a todos sus contenedores. |
get |
GET /accounts/accountId/permissions/permissionId
|
Obtiene la cuenta del usuario y los permisos del contenedor. |
list |
GET /accounts/accountId/permissions
|
Enumera todos los usuarios que tienen acceso a la cuenta, además de los permisos de cuenta y contenedor otorgados a cada uno de ellos. |
actualizar |
PUT /accounts/accountId/permissions/permissionId
|
Actualiza la cuenta del usuario y los permisos del contenedor. |
Etiquetas
Para obtener más información sobre los recursos de etiquetas,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/tags
|
Crea una etiqueta de GTM. |
borrar |
DELETE /accounts/accountId/containers/containerId/tags/tagId
|
Elimina una etiqueta de GTM. |
get |
GET /accounts/accountId/containers/containerId/tags/tagId
|
Obtiene una etiqueta de GTM. |
list |
GET /accounts/accountId/containers/containerId/tags
|
Muestra una lista de todas las etiquetas de GTM de un contenedor. |
actualizar |
PUT /accounts/accountId/containers/containerId/tags/tagId
|
Actualiza una etiqueta de GTM. |
Activadores
Para obtener más información sobre los recursos de activadores,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/triggers
|
Crea un activador de GTM. |
borrar |
DELETE /accounts/accountId/containers/containerId/triggers/triggerId
|
Borra un activador de GTM. |
get |
GET /accounts/accountId/containers/containerId/triggers/triggerId
|
Obtiene un activador de GTM. |
list |
GET /accounts/accountId/containers/containerId/triggers
|
Muestra una lista de todos los activadores de GTM de un contenedor. |
actualizar |
PUT /accounts/accountId/containers/containerId/triggers/triggerId
|
Actualiza un activador de GTM. |
Variables
Para obtener más información sobre los recursos de variables, consulta la página de representación de recursos.
Método | Solicitud HTTP | Descripción |
---|---|---|
URI relacionados con https://www.googleapis.com/tagmanager/v1, a menos que se indique lo contrario | ||
crear |
POST /accounts/accountId/containers/containerId/variables
|
Crea una variable de GTM. |
borrar |
DELETE /accounts/accountId/containers/containerId/variables/variableId
|
Borra una variable de GTM. |
get |
GET /accounts/accountId/containers/containerId/variables/variableId
|
Obtiene una variable de GTM. |
list |
GET /accounts/accountId/containers/containerId/variables
|
Muestra una lista de todas las variables de GTM de un contenedor. |
actualizar |
PUT /accounts/accountId/containers/containerId/variables/variableId
|
Actualiza una variable de GTM. |